新化合物HNPC-A14343/14344的殺螨活性研究 |
鄭 希1,2,3,柳愛(ài)平2,3,閆忠忠2,3,4,裴 暉2,3,劉興平2,3,黃 路2,3,徐滿(mǎn)才1,劉衛東2,3*
(1. 湖南師范大學(xué) 化學(xué)化工學(xué)院,湖南 長(cháng)沙 410081;2. 湖南化工研究院有限公司,國家農藥創(chuàng )制工程技術(shù)研究中心,湖南 長(cháng)沙 410007;3. 農用化學(xué)品湖南省重點(diǎn)實(shí)驗室,湖南 長(cháng)沙 410014;4. 湖南大學(xué)化學(xué)化工學(xué)院 長(cháng)沙 410082) |
摘 要:為了研究新化合物HNPC-A14343及其異構體HNPC-A14344對害螨的殺螨活性,采用浸漬法研究了HNPC-A14343和HNPC-A14344及其1∶1的混合物對棉紅蜘蛛的殺螨活性,其對害螨的活性經(jīng)溫室和田間小區防治山楂葉螨和柑桔紅蜘蛛的藥效試驗確證。試驗結果表明,HNPC-A14343/14344對棉紅蜘蛛具有高活性,LC50值為0.35~0.41 mg/L;溫室和田間試驗結果也表明,HNPC-A14343/14344對山楂葉螨和柑桔紅蜘蛛的防治效果與同等劑量條件下的對照藥劑螺螨酯處于同一水平,且速效性?xún)?yōu)于螺螨酯,具有進(jìn)一步研究與開(kāi)發(fā)價(jià)值。 |
關(guān)鍵詞:HNPC-A14343/A14344;殺螨活性;螺螨酯 |

Study on the Acaricidal activity of HNPC-A14343/14344 |

Abstract:In order to study the acaricidal activity of HNPC-A14343 and its isomer HNPC-A14344, the acaricidal activity against tetrany chuscinnabarinus of HNPC-A14343/14344 and their 1∶1 mixture by immersion method were studied, and their acaricidal activities against Tetranychus viennensis and Panonychuscitri McGregorwere confirmed in the greenhouse and field trials. The results indicated that HNPC-A14343/14344 exhibited high levels of acaricidal activity against tetranychus cinnabarinus at the value of LC50 0.35~0.41 mg/L. The greenhouse and field trials also showed that the efficacy of HNPC-A14343/14344 against Tetranychus viennensis and Panonychuscitri McGregorwere were comparable to that of spirodiclofen, and HNPC-A14343/14344 were valuable for further research and development. |
Key words:HNPC-A14343 and HNPC-A14344; acaricide; Spirodiclofen |
